#5755a4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5755a4 is composed of 34.1% red, 33.3%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47% cyan, 48.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 241.5 degrees, a saturation of 31.7% and a lightness of 48.8%. #5755a4 color hex could be obtained by blending #aeaaff with #000049.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#5755a4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050509 is the darkest color, while #fbfb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5755a4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b7b7e is the less saturated color, while #0e08f1 is the most saturated one.
